Sec. 1845. Facility clearance acceleration for members of defense industrial consortiums

The Secretary of Defense shall ensure that each entity that is a member of the collaborative forum described in section 1844(a) of this Act— is sponsored for a facility clearance; is provided access to sensitive compartmented information facilities and classified networks where the member can perform classified work; and not less than quarterly, is invited to in-person meetings with relevant personnel of the Department of Defense to discuss classified information. Not later than 90 days after the date of the enactment of this Act, the Secretary of Defense shall submit to the congressional defense committees a report detailing a plan to increase the number of facility clearances provided to members described in subsection
(a)or to companies awarded contracts in accordance with Executive Order 12968. Such plan shall include— an assessment of any existing related efforts to increase sensitive compartmented information facilities and how such efforts might be accelerated and elevated in priority; target metrics for increased facility clearances in association with membership in the collaborative forum described in subsection
(a)or to companies awarded contracts in accordance with Executive Order 12968; an identification of any additional funding or authorities required to support increased processing of facility clearances; and any other matters the Secretary of Defense considers relevant.
